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Crested Capuchin | vagrant emperor |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(hewan) | Animalia (hewan)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Artropoda) |
| Class | Mammalia (mamalia) | Insecta (serangga) |
| Order | Primates (Primata) | Odonata (Odonata) |
| Family | Cebidae | Aeshnidae |
| Genus | Sapajus | Anax |
| Species | Sapajus robustus | Anax ephippiger |
